About this work

The image depicts a portrait of a man with a bald head, rendered in black and white. His facial features are accentuated, with prominent eyebrows, a nose, and a mouth. The man's right hand is raised to his chin, and his gaze is directed to the right. The background of the image is a light color, which contrasts with the darker tones of the subject. A notable aspect of the portrait is the expressive use of lines and shading, which adds depth and texture to the image. The artist's skillful application of these techniques creates a sense of volume and dimensionality, drawing the viewer's attention to the subject's facial features.
